Aquitaine
 

As far as you can see, a long, golden, beautiful beach on which ocean waves come and die: 270 kilometers of protected shore, from the Pointe de Grave headland to the Bidassoa river, at the foot of the Pyrenees. Aquitaine provides beginners or experienced surf-lovers with the best surfs in Europe. Behind the dune bar that, despite man's efforts, keeps on creeping over land, a forest was planted a century ago: more than one million hectares of maritime pines that hold the dunes.

Shaped by the turmoil of history, Aquitaine is a region where the vestiges of ancient times remain in great numbers. To the North, the Périgord region, "the cradle of art and humanity", offers many prehistoric sites which pass on the moving artistic message of man's thousand year old evolution. Prestigious vestiges as Lascaux, the prehistoric "Sistine chapel", Madeleine, Rouffignac, Eyzies de Tayac; they attract thousands of visitors each year.
The Pyrenees mountain, which in its Basque part exceeds 2,000 meters only at Pic d'Orthy, offers its green meadows, its moor and above all its typical villages where tradition and folklore still mingle with natives' life for tourists' delight (Basque pelota, strength games, dances and fairs). Further South, the Pyrenees range rises as to offer in the Natural Park's magnificent setting, every instance of mountain sports, summer hiking, climbing, as well as snow fields and developped resorts that allow the practice of all the winter sports.

 

History has sometimes such mischievous ways ! Aquitaine. The land of water, so called by Julius Caesar, is also a land which yields the most famous wineyards in the world. In Aquitaine, you will see, nobody escapes the wine tradition. Whether you own a vine or not, whether you are a brotherhood member, enlightened amateur or simple neophyte, it doesn't matter ! More than two thousand years of communal life have woven close ties between man and vine.
